egg-plant, n.
- A plant (
Solanum Melongena ), of East Indian origin, allied to the tomato, and bearing a large, glossy, edible fruit, shaped somewhat like an egg; mad-apple. It is widely cultivated for its fruit, commonly eaten as a vegetable. [1913 Webster] - The fruit of the eggplant{1}. [PJC]
